A practical method to synthesize -heteroaryl esters from -heteroaryl methanols with acyl cyanides C-C bond cleavage without using any transition metal is demonstrated here. The use of NaCO/15-crown-5 couple enables access to a series of -heteroaryl esters in high efficiency. This protocol is operationally simple and highly environmentally benign producing only cyanides as byproducts.
